Working with these fonts
Not found on Google Fonts? Please follow the suggested flow that can help:
- Open the company's homepage in a browser with DevTools open.
- In the Network tab, filter by "Font" (or by extension: woff2, woff, ttf, otf).
- Hard-reload the page and click around (pricing, blog, careers) — some weights only load on specific routes.
- For each captured font URL: right-click → Save As to download the file locally.
- View the page's CSS (DevTools → Sources, or curl the stylesheet URLs) and copy out the matching @font-face declarations. Rewrite each
src: url(...)to point to your local file path.
Programmatic alternative: load the URL with Playwright or Puppeteer, listen for response events whose Content-Type starts with font/, and write the body to disk. The CSS extraction step is the same.
Only do this if you have permission to use the brand assets — most proprietary fonts are licensed and may not be redistributable.
